A developer has publicly shared Davit, an open-source User Interface (UI) designed for managing Apple Containers. The project, posted on Show HN, aims to provide a more accessible and streamlined way for developers to interact with Apple Containers, which are used for app data management and sandboxing on Apple platforms.
Davit is a front-end UI built with a vibe-coded aesthetic, inspired by Apple’s design language. The project is available as open source, allowing developers to review, modify, and potentially integrate it into their workflows. The creator of Davit expressed a personal interest in simplifying the process of working with Apple Containers, which are typically accessed via command-line tools or Xcode.
The source code for Davit has been shared publicly on Show HN, a platform for developers to showcase projects and gather feedback. The UI aims to offer an intuitive interface for browsing, editing, and managing container data, which is often complex and opaque when accessed through traditional methods. The developer noted that while the tool is primarily a personal project, they are open to others adopting or contributing to it.

Background on Apple Containers and Developer Tools
Apple Containers are a core component of iOS and macOS app sandboxing, isolating app data for security and privacy. Traditionally, developers access container data through command-line tools or Xcode, which can be complex and unintuitive. While Apple provides official tools for container management, there has been a demand for more user-friendly, visual interfaces.
In recent years, various third-party tools have emerged to simplify container management, but few have gained significant traction. The release of Davit on Show HN reflects ongoing community interest in improving developer workflows and making system management more accessible through open-source projects. Key Questions
What exactly does Davit do?
Davit provides a graphical user interface for browsing, editing, and managing Apple Containers, aiming to replace or supplement command-line tools with a more visual, user-friendly approach.
Is Davit officially supported by Apple?
No, Davit is an independent, open-source project created by a developer and is not officially endorsed or supported by Apple.
Can I contribute to Davit?
Yes, since the source code is publicly available, developers interested in improving or customizing Davit can contribute via the project’s repository, typically hosted on platforms like GitHub.
